The Role of Customer Service in Casinos

Customer service plays a pivotal role in the success and reputation of casinos. In an industry where competition is fierce and customer loyalty is crucial, providing exceptional service can differentiate one casino from another. Effective customer service ensures that players feel valued, supported, and comfortable, which enhances their overall gaming experience and encourages repeat visits.

General aspects of customer service in casinos include prompt assistance, knowledgeable staff, and personalized attention. Casinos invest heavily in training their employees to handle a variety of situations, from resolving disputes to offering game guidance. The quality of these interactions can significantly impact a player’s perception of the establishment and influence their decision to return or recommend the casino to others.
